Welcome home to this beautifully maintained 4-bedroom, 2-bath home situated on approximately 2 scenic acres in Gadsden! Enjoy peaceful mountain views and a picturesque backyard while being less than 3 miles from Noccalula Falls Park. The updated kitchen features beautiful granite countertops, and all kitchen appliances—including the refrigerator, stove, and dishwasher—remain with the home. The washer and dryer also stay! Major updates completed approximately 3–4 years ago include a 40-year roof, HVAC, water heater, flooring, stove, dishwasher, and oversized 6-inch gutters. The low-maintenance vinyl exterior and septic system, professionally inspected and pumped approximately 3 years ago, add even more value. If you're looking for country-style living with modern updates and convenient access to one of the area's most popular attractions, this property is a must-see!
